Hilaire POIRIER was born abt. 1747 in Acadia, Canada

Hilaire POIRIER was the child of Pierre POIRIER   and   Marguerite ARSENAULT (ARCENAULT) (ARSENEAU) and the grandchild of: (paternal)  Louis POIRIER and Cecile MIGNAULT (MIGNEAULT) (maternal)  Charles ARSENAULT (ARCENAULT) (ARSENEAU) and Françoise MIRANDE LAMIRANDE-TAVARE

Hilaire was deported as part of the Acadian Exile / Grand Derangement around 1755.

Spouse(s)/Partner(s) and Child(ren):

Hilaire  married  Angelique DUGAS 8 November 1773 in Carleton-sur-Mer, Province of Québec, Canada .  The couple had (at least) 9 children.
Angelique DUGAS  was born abt. 1750 Angelique died 30 November 1825 in Saint-Jacques, Québec, Canada (Saint-Jacques-de-Montcalm) (Saint Jacques de l’Achigan).  Angelique was the child of Charles DUGAS and Anne LEBLANC.

Hilaire POIRIER died 28 May 1836 in Saint-Jacques, Lower Canada .

Did You Know? Québec Généalogie - Over time, Québec has gone through a series of name changes
From its inception in the early 1600s until 1760, it was called Canada, New France.
1760 to 1763, it was simply Canada
1763 to 1791 - Province of Québec
1791 to 1867 - Lower Canada
1867 to present - Québec, Canada.
